Hallo nochmal, Kannst Du mir noch einen Tip zum kompilieren von kmm-plugin geben? Ich kann Dein package nicht verwenden - amd64 - und habe daher folgendes versucht:
wget -O kmm_banking-0.9.6beta.tar.gz \ 'http://www.aquamaniac.de/sites/download/download.php?package=05&release=04&file=01&dummy=kmm_banking-0.9.6beta.tar.gz' tar xzf kmm_banking-0.9.6beta.tar.gz ln -s kmm_banking-0.9.6beta kmm-banking-0.9.6beta cd kmm-banking-0.9.6beta aptitude install autotools-dev fakeroot dh-make build-essential libgwenhywfar47-dev libaqbanking20-dev dh_make -s -e [EMAIL PROTECTED] --createorig comment-out "distclean" in debian/rules dpkg-buildpackage -rfakeroot -uc -us Das liefert mir den fehler: collect2: ld returned 1 exit status make[4]: *** [kmm_kbanking.la] Error 1 make[4]: Leaving directory `/usr/src/kmymoney2/kmm_banking-0.9.6beta/src' make[3]: *** [all-recursive] Error 1 make[3]: Leaving directory `/usr/src/kmymoney2/kmm_banking-0.9.6beta/src' make[2]: *** [all-recursive] Error 1 make[2]: Leaving directory `/usr/src/kmymoney2/kmm_banking-0.9.6beta' make[1]: *** [all] Error 2 make[1]: Leaving directory `/usr/src/kmymoney2/kmm_banking-0.9.6beta' make: *** [build-stamp] Error 2 dpkg-buildpackage: failure: debian/rules build gave error exit status 2 Was check ich jetzt nicht? Danke, Joh Micha Lenk wrote: > Hallo Johannes, > > On Thu, Apr 03, 2008 at 11:16:31AM +0200, Johannes Graumann wrote: >> Der Versuch den plugin zu kompilieren scheitert mit folgendem Fehler: >> >> mymoneybanking.cpp: In member function 'void >> KMyMoneyBanking::_xaToStatement(const AB_TRANSACTION*, >> MyMoneyStatement&)': mymoneybanking.cpp:451: error: 'struct >> MyMoneyStatement::Transaction' has no member named 'm_fees' >> [...] >> >> Was mach' ich falsch? > > Du brauchst erstmal KMyMoney2 in Version 0.8.9. Einen Patch, der das > aktuelle Debian-Source-Paket auf Version 0.8.9 bringt, findest du in > http://bugs.debian.org/472827 > > D.h. du führst am einfachsten jetzt folgende Befehle aus: > > apt-get install build-essential devscripts fakeroot > apt-get build-dep kmymoney2 > wget -O kmymoney2-0.8.9.tar.bz2 \ > 'http://downloads.sourceforge.net/kmymoney2/kmymoney2-0.8.9.tar.bz2?modtime=1206374511&big_mirror=0' > wget > http://ftp.debian.org/debian/pool/main/k/kmymoney2/kmymoney2_0.8.8-2.diff.gz > wget -O kmymoney2-0.8.9-upgrade.diff \ > 'http://bugs.debian.org/cgi-bin/bugreport.cgi?msg=27;filename=kmymoney2-0.8.9-upgrade.diff;att=1;bug=472827' > tar -xjf kmymoney2-0.8.9.tar.bz2 > tar -czf kmymoney2_0.8.9.orig.tar.gz kmymoney2-0.8.9 > gunzip -c kmymoney2_0.8.8-2.diff.gz | patch -d kmymoney2-0.8.9 -p1 > patch -d kmymoney2-0.8.9 -p1 < kmymoney2-0.8.9-upgrade.diff > cd kmymoney2-0.8.9 > dpkg-buildpackage -rfakeroot -uc -us > > ... und am Ende solltest du ein Debian-Paket haben, mit dem sich das > AqBanking-Plugin übersetzen lässt. Du kannst dann aber auch einfach das > von mir gebaute AqBanking-Plugin-Paket installieren, das du hier finden > kannst: > > http://aqbanking.alioth.debian.org/debian/unstable/kmymoney2-plugin-aqbanking_0.9.6beta-1_i386.deb > > Schöne Grüße > Micha > > ------------------------------------------------------------------------- > Check out the new SourceForge.net Marketplace. > It's the best place to buy or sell services for > just about anything Open Source. > http://ad.doubleclick.net/clk;164216239;13503038;w?http://sf.net/marketplace ------------------------------------------------------------------------- Check out the new SourceForge.net Marketplace. It's the best place to buy or sell services for just about anything Open Source. http://ad.doubleclick.net/clk;164216239;13503038;w?http://sf.net/marketplace _______________________________________________ Aqbanking-devel mailing list Aqbanking-devel@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/aqbanking-devel